    The San Carlos Hotel is a historic hotel in Yuma, Arizona. Its construction cost $300,000, [2] and it was completed in 1930. [3] It was five stories high, with 107 bedrooms. [2] It was remodelled into 59 residential apartments in the 1980s. [3] The current owner announced plans to sell the building in 2024. [4]

    The Lett Hotel at 204 S. Ash in Yuma, Colorado, now known as the Tumbleweed Hotel, is a historic building, built in 1916, that is listed on the National Register of Historic Places. It was the longest operating hotel in Yuma, and had served 73 years at the time of its NRHP listing in 1990.

    Somerton is a city in Yuma County, Arizona, United States. As of the 2010 census the population was 14,287. [3] It is part of the Yuma Metropolitan Statistical Area. Somerton was established in 1898 and incorporated in 1918. Somerton's economy is based on agriculture, medical services, and tourism. [4]
